
Development and design
Japan developed the Type 87 as a locally produced close air-defense system for mechanized formations. The vehicle combines a Type 74-derived chassis with twin 35 mm cannon and integrated search/tracking radar. 1, 2
Operational use
The system entered JGSDF service in the late 1980s and has equipped dedicated air-defense companies supporting armored units, especially the mechanized forces in Hokkaido. 1, 2
Role and significance
Type 87 is Japan’s counterpart to systems such as Gepard: a radar-equipped tracked gun platform designed to accompany tanks rather than defend from a fixed site. 1, 2
